Top Story: Amorim's Winning Run Ends in Milan Derby Draw

Ruben Amorim has called for patience after his winning run as AC Milan manager came to a halt on Sunday, with his side held to a 1-1 draw against Juventus. The result ends a perfect start for the Portuguese coach, who now must regroup his squad as the Serie A title race tightens. Meanwhile, across the league, Inter proved they are the team to beat in Serie A according to Gab Marcotti, as the defending champions continue to set the standard.

Premier League: Arsenal Statement Win, Chelsea's Woes Continue

Arsenal came from behind to record a statement 2-1 win in a vintage London derby against Chelsea at the Emirates on Sunday. The victory showcased why Mikel Arteta's side is considered the team to beat in England, but it also exposed significant issues for the visitors. Xabi Alonso said Chelsea must address their defensive frailties after the defeat took their goals conceded tally to seven in just three games this season.

Manchester United's struggles continue, as they are just three games into the new season but have already dropped points twice, most recently in a 2-2 draw with Everton. The result raises questions about whether the Red Devils remain a work in progress under their current management. Elsewhere, a new camera angle shows the ball coming off Nottingham Forest defender Neco Williams' arms as he scores his disallowed goal against Tottenham, but the footage won't end the ongoing VAR controversy. In transfer news, Chelsea showed late interest in Fulham's Sander Berge as they attempted to strengthen their midfield options before Enzo Fernandez's departure.

Ballon d'Or Race: Kane, Mbappé and the History Question

Harry Kane has said he is happy to be in contention for the Ballon d'Or and that he is "extremely proud" of his stunning goalscoring campaign last season, hoping his best season earns him the historic award. However, history suggests Ballon d'Or winners come from those who have recently lifted one of football's biggest trophies, and the question remains whether Kane can become a rare exception. Kylian Mbappé launched a passionate defence of his playing style, denying that his work-rate off the ball alongside teammate Vinícius Júnior is an issue for Real Madrid, while also talking up his Ballon d'Or hopes. The French forward says this could be a good year for him to win the award for the first time, as he targets his first Ballon d'Or at the Bernabéu.

USMNT and International News

USMNT coach Mauricio Pochettino said he hasn't spoken with U.S. and AS Monaco striker Folarin Balogun about his aborted move to Everton, but plans to in the coming days to offer his support, saying the striker must find the best place to perform. The Belgian football federation said it can't support Gianni Infantino's bid for another term as FIFA president, citing transparency and governance issues and the way FIFA handled clearing Balogun in a controversial red card case. The United States lost its opening match at the U20 Women's World Cup on Sunday in Lódź, Poland, falling 2-1 to Italy, a result that leaves the Americans in an early hole in a difficult group.

Club News and Management Changes

Global head of football Edu has left Nottingham Forest after just over a year at the City Ground. Liverpool are seeking their fifth sporting director since 2022, with questions over who will succeed Richard Hughes and what issues they will face in the wide-ranging role. Shrewsbury Town's long-running takeover saga is set to end after an American consortium was granted approval to buy the club by the EFL. Ex-Wales captain Ashley Williams and former Swansea boss Alan Sheehan have joined Craig Bellamy's backroom staff before Wales' Nations League campaign.
